  • Abstract
    Opportunistic Network is a special kind of Challenged Networks in which the path between the source and the destination is not persistent in all times. Any cast is a new "one-to-one-of-many" communication method. Although some any cast schemes have been designed and proposed for opportunistic networks, few of them have discussed how any cast was carried out in detail. In this paper, we present an entire any cast communication model (ACM) to describe any cast communication processes and activities. Firstly, we describe the environment of opportunistic networks. Secondly, we propose the framework, components and basic activities of the any cast communication model. Lastly, we analyze and verify the availability of ACM based on a colored Petri Nets (CPN).
